Bangladesh government prohibits its nationals from traveling to Libya over fragile security
Bangladeshis are not allowed to go to Libya as the law and order situation in the country is not safe for them, Indian State Minister for Foreign Affairs Shahriar Alam said Sunday.
“The government currently is not allowing Bangladeshi migrants to go to North African country Libya due to security reasons,” the state minister said while addressing a seminar in the capital city.
The state minister told the seminar that the government is always aware about the safety and security of the migrant workers and the people going abroad.
Despite the awareness, many job seekers became victim of fraudulent activities after going abroad through illegal channels, Shahriar said adding that legal actions had also been taken against the people who were involved in such criminal activities.
